다음을 통해 공유


CREATESTRUCT 구조체

CREATESTRUCT 구조는 응용 프로그램의 창 프로시저에 전달 된 초기화 매개 변수를 정의 합니다.

typedef struct tagCREATESTRUCT {
   LPVOID lpCreateParams;
   HANDLE hInstance;
   HMENU hMenu;
   HWND hwndParent;
   int cy;
   int cx;
   int y;
   int x;
   LONG style;
   LPCSTR lpszName;
   LPCSTR lpszClass;
   DWORD dwExStyle;
} CREATESTRUCT;

매개 변수

  • lpCreateParams
    창을 만드는 데 사용할 수 있는 데이터를 가리킵니다.

  • hInstance
    새 창에 소유 하 고 있는 모듈의 모듈 인스턴스 핸들을 식별 합니다.

  • hMenu
    새 창을 여는 데 사용할 수 있는 메뉴를 나타냅니다.자식 창의 경우는 정수 ID를 포함 합니다.

  • hwndParent
    새 창을 소유 하는 창으로 식별 합니다.이 멤버는 NULL 새 창이 최상위 창인 경우.

  • cy
    새 창의 높이 지정합니다.

  • cx
    새 창의 너비를 지정합니다.

  • y
    새 창의 왼쪽된 위 모서리의 y 좌표를 지정합니다.새 창의 자식 창에 있는 경우 좌표 기준으로 부모 창입니다. 그렇지 않으면 좌표는 원점을 기준으로 화면입니다.

  • x
    새 창의 왼쪽된 위 모서리의 x 좌표를 지정합니다.새 창의 자식 창에 있는 경우 좌표 기준으로 부모 창입니다. 그렇지 않으면 좌표는 원점을 기준으로 화면입니다.

  • style
    새 창의 지정 스타일.

  • lpszName
    새 창에 이름을 지정 하는 null로 끝나는 문자열을 가리킵니다.

  • lpszClass
    새 창의 Windows 클래스의 이름을 지정 하는 null로 끝나는 문자열을 가리키는 (에 WNDCLASS 구조체입니다. 자세한 내용은 Windows SDK).

  • dwExStyle
    지정은 확장된 스타일 새 창에 대 한.

요구 사항

헤더: winuser.h

참고 항목

참조

CWnd::OnCreate

기타 리소스

구조, 스타일, 콜백 및 메시지 맵